State Health Care Coalitions What are Health Care Coalitions (HCCs)? HCCs are groups of local health care and responder organizations that work together on challenges and find solutions that improve emergency preparedness and the health and safety of their communities. How many times has this ... A coalition is a group (set) of players joining forces to vote the same way on a motion. (We allow one player alone to be a coalition.) The weight of a coalition is the sum of the weights of the players in it. A coalition is a winning coalition if its weight equals or exceeds the quota. Conflict in a coalition is normal – in fact, it’s usually a sign that the coalition or network is quite strong and engaged. Its members are passionate and involved, suggesting there is something “worth fighting for.”.
